Nestled in the Crowsnest Pass, this historic mining town offers scenic hikes along Frank Slide Trail and excellent fly fishing in Crowsnest River. Visit the Leitch Collieries Provincial Historic Site nearby or enjoy winter skiing at Pass Powderkeg Ski Area when snow blankets the mountains.

Best time to go to Blairmore

The best time to visit Blairmore is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ain. December is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with no r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January21.0°F (-6.1°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
February19.6°F (-6.9°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March28.9°F (-1.7°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
April37.0°F (2.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May47.5°F (8.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June55.8°F (13.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
July63.3°F (17.4°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August62.6°F (17.0°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
September53.6°F (12.0°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
October39.6°F (4.2°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
November27.9°F (-2.3°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December19.2°F (-7.1°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Blairmore

When planning your trip to Blairmore, Alberta, you can fly into three major airports. Kalispell, MT (FCA-Glacier Park Intl.) is located 90 miles away, with nearby hotels like Lodge at Whitefish Lake and Firebrand Hotel, both offering free shuttle services. Cranbrook, BC (YXC-Canadian Rockies Intl.) is 60 miles from Blairmore; St. Eugene Golf Resort & Casino and Prestige Rocky Mountain Resort are excellent hotel choices nearby, both easily accessible to the airport. Lastly, Lethbridge, AB (YQL-Lethbridge County) is 74 miles away, with options like Holiday Inn Lethbridge and Sandman Hotel offering convenient access to the airport.

When is the best time to go to Blairmore?
For outdoor enthusiasts, the best time to go to Blairmore is generally from late spring to early fall, specifically June to September, for pleasant weather and full access to activities.During these months, the weather is warm and sunny, making it ideal for hiking, mountain biking, and exploring the surrounding Crowsnest Pass. The trails are typically free of snow, and the lakes are suitable for swimming or paddling. This period also sees longer daylight hours, allowing for extended outdoor adventures.For those interested in winter sports, the period from December to March offers excellent conditions for skiing, snowboarding, and snowshoeing. The area receives ample snowfall, and nearby resorts are fully operational.
